如何同一张表用填报预览和分页预览展示?

同一张表格在平台上挂出,一张设置填报,一张设置预览,想要编辑只在填报时可用,弹出的报表也是在编辑可用时才是填报状态,怎么获取是预览状态还是填报状态?

image.png

FineReport yzm120806 发布于 2024-11-15 09:46
1min目标场景问卷 立即参与
回答问题
悬赏:3 F币 + 添加悬赏
提示:增加悬赏、完善问题、追问等操作,可使您的问题被置顶,并向所有关注者发送通知
共2回答
最佳回答
0
FR-LeonLv4初级互助
发布于2024-11-15 09:50(编辑于 2024-11-15 10:12)

跳转的填报链接 加参数op=wirte

通过JS获取当前页面URL网址信息

  • yzm120806 yzm120806(提问者) 那用于预览的时候弹出的表不还是能编辑吗
    2024-11-15 09:51 
  • FR-Leon FR-Leon 回复 yzm120806(提问者) 预览的是op=view
    2024-11-15 09:52 
  • FR-Leon FR-Leon 回复 yzm120806(提问者) 你可以单独预览模板,看一下URL后面的参数值,不同的预览参数值不一样
    2024-11-15 09:53 
  • yzm120806 yzm120806(提问者) 回复 FR-Leon 我知道这个,我的意思是底表在填报的时候弹出框也是填报,底表预览的时候弹出表也是预览
    2024-11-15 10:08 
最佳回答
0
CD20160914Lv8专家互助
发布于2024-11-15 10:09

直接挂分页预览,然后比如你要填报的时候,用户点击一下按钮。里面的js代码如下

放在决策平台看。

var url = new URL(window.location.href);

url.searchParams.set('op', 'write');

window.location.href = url.href;

  • 3关注人数
  • 157浏览人数
  • 最后回答于:2024-11-15 10:12
    请选择关闭问题的原因
    确定 取消
    返回顶部